Alaska Permanent Fund Corp Decreases Holdings in Invesco S&P 500 Low Volatility ETF (NYSEARCA:SPLV)

Alaska Permanent Fund Corp decreased its position in shares of Invesco S&P 500 Low Volatility ETF (NYSEARCA:SPLVFree Report) by 13.3%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 2,814,726 shares of the company’s stock after selling 432,196 shares during the period. Invesco S&P 500 Low Volatility ETF accounts for 2.9% of Alaska Permanent Fund Corp’s holdings, making the stock its 11th biggest position. Alaska Permanent Fund Corp owned 1.92% of Invesco S&P 500 Low Volatility ETF worth $176,371,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Invesco S&P 500 Low Volatility ETF

(Free Report)

The Invesco S&P 500 Low Volatility ETF (SPLV)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P 500 Low Volatility index. The fund tracks a volatility-weighted index of the 100 least-volatile stocks in the S&P 500. SPLV was launched on May 5, 2011 and is managed by Invesco.
